For Clackamas residents looking to manage their money with a more personal touch, exploring your nearest credit union can be a fantastic financial move. Unlike national banks, credit unions are not-for-profit financial cooperatives owned by their members. This often translates to lower fees, better interest rates on savings accounts and loans, and a strong focus on local community support. When searching for your nearest credit union in Clackamas, you'll quickly find that two major community-focused institutions have a significant presence here: OnPoint Community Credit Union and Unitus Community Credit Union. Both have deep roots in the Portland metro area and offer full-service banking with a member-centric philosophy. For instance, OnPoint has a branch conveniently located on SE 82nd Drive, making it highly accessible for many in the community. Unitus also serves the area with a focus on personalized service. The key advantage of these credit unions is their local decision-making; loan applications are often reviewed by people who understand the Clackamas community, not a distant corporate office.

Credit unions frequently excel in these areas. A great first step is to check your eligibility. Most credit unions have a community-based field of membership. Living, working, or worshipping in Clackamas County often qualifies you to join OnPoint or Unitus.
